What will you learn in SafetyQuest: Level Four - Mastering QI course

  • Utilize Lean principles such as 5S and reducing waste to improve quality of care for your patients
  • Analyze quality improvement data using statistical process control
  • Apply high value care to your practice
  • Identify systemic risks in clinical environments using gamified simulations
  • Strengthen team-based problem solving for safer patient outcomes

Program Overview

Module 1: Foundations of Quality Improvement in Healthcare

Estimated 3 days

  • Introduction to patient safety and error prevention
  • Core concepts of quality improvement (QI)
  • Role of teamwork in reducing clinical errors

Module 2: Lean Methodologies in Clinical Practice

Duration: 4 days

  • Applying 5S to clinical workflows
  • Identifying and eliminating waste in care delivery
  • Case studies in operational efficiency

Module 3: Data-Driven Quality Improvement

Duration: 5 days

  • Introduction to statistical process control (SPC)
  • Interpreting run charts and control charts
  • Using data to guide improvement cycles

Module 4: High-Value Care and Sustainable Outcomes

Duration: 4 days

  • Defining high-value care in clinical settings
  • Aligning QI initiatives with patient-centered goals
  • Strategies for sustaining improvements over time

Supplementary Resources

  • Book: 'The Improvement Guide' by Langley et al. expands on QI frameworks taught. A go-to reference for leading real-world improvement projects.
  • Tool: Minitab or Excel for practicing control charts and data analysis. Reinforces SPC concepts with hands-on data manipulation.
  • Follow-up: Enroll in IHI Open School courses for broader patient safety training. Complements SafetyQuest with additional frameworks and case studies.
  • Reference: Institute for Healthcare Improvement (IHI) website offers toolkits and templates. Supports implementation of Lean and high-value care strategies.
